Published in 2022 at "Organic letters"
DOI: 10.1021/acs.orglett.2c02626
Abstract: An electrochemical amidation of benzoyl hydrazine/carbazate and primary/secondary amine as coupling partners via concomitant cleavage and formation of C(sp2)-N bonds has been achieved. This methodology proceeds under metal-free and exogenous oxidant-free conditions producing N2 and…

Published in 2019 at "Molecules"
DOI: 10.3390/molecules24071216
Abstract: The recent developments in asymmetric A3 (aldehyde–alkyne–amine) coupling has been summarized in this review. Several interesting modifications of the ligands enabled the highly enantioselective synthesis of chiral propargylamines, which are further used in the construction…

Published in 2021 at "Molecules"
DOI: 10.3390/molecules26247507
Abstract: A convergent synthesis of cationic amphiphilic compounds is reported here with the use of the phosphonodithioester–amine coupling (PAC) reaction. This versatile reaction occurs at room temperature without any catalyst, allowing binding of the lipid moiety…
